Structured Follow-Up and Recovery Plan

To ensure optimal healing and functional recovery, Dr. Amal provides a structured follow-up schedule:
  • Weekly follow-up appointments during the first month
  • Biweekly visits during the second month
  • Monthly reviews thereafter, depending on progress
  • Diagnostic imaging (X-ray, CT, MRI) as clinically indicated
